A small C18 or early C19 timber-framed and plastered cottage standing at right angles to the range including Crispen Cottage, at the north-west end. 1 storey and attics. Casement windows. Roof corrugated iron. Included for group value.
Lidgate Stores, John O Lidgate's House, Crispen Cottage, and adjoining premises, Cottage to the north-west of Crispen Cottage and Lidgate Cottage form a group.
